I've just started using STATA, apologies for my very basic question.
I'm trying to obtain Odds Ratios and measures of fit after running an ordered logistic regression using ologit in STATA 16. However, I don't seem to be able to install the spost13_ado package. It's neither found when typing search spost13_ado nor can I install it using the direct . net from http://www.indiana.edu/~jslsoc/stata/ command (or as recommended by stata: . net from https://www.indiana.edu/~jslsoc/stata/stata.toc), even though I'm connected to the internet and can find the file when searching for it by hand.
The internet seems to suggest that the package worked in STATA 15, does it have anything to do with me using STATA 16? I've also checked for all updates as recommended and still wasn't successful.
